The federal government has decided to take an action against the three members of Pakistan Electronic Media Regulatory Authority (PEMRA) who conducted a meeting alone and made a decision to ban Geo News.
According to the sources, the government has issued show cause notices to PEMRA members Israr Abbasi, Mian Shams and Fareeha Ikhtiar. These officials had announced recently to suspend Geo’s three licenses after a meeting held this Tuesday. Announcing immediate suspension of their broadcasting licences, these members had issued directives to seal the offices of three Geo channels. A few hours later, the PEMRA spokesperson announced the meeting as illegal.
Whereas the Information Minister, Perveiz Rasheed, stressed the apology by the channel should be accepted and people should let the government deal with challenges like the threat of terrorism and energy crisis. He added that, “Issue is not of a closure of any channel but is of freedom of expression.” He was talking to the media reporters outside Hamid Mir’s house where he went to inquire about his health. To a question he answered that Pakistan Electronic Media Regulatory Authority (PEMRA) was an independent institution and would not be dictated by anyone.
